This center tap Schottky rectifier has been optimized for
ultra low forward voltage drop specifically for 3.3V output
power supplies. The proprietary barrier technology allows
for reliable operation up to 150 °C junction temperature.
Typical applications are in parallel switching power sup-
plies, converters, reverse battery protection, and redundant
power subsystems.
